Title:
LASER DEVICE
Document Type and Number:
WIPO Patent Application WO/2008/029859
Kind Code:
A1
Abstract:
A laser device (300) comprising a DFB fiber laser (40) having as an amplifying medium a rare earth added silica-based optical fiber containing aluminum codoped at high concentration, an optical feedback path (50) formed by a ring-form optical fiber, and an optical coupler (70) for feeding back part of an output from the DFB fiber laser (40) to the DFB fiber laser (40) via the optical feedback path (50) and outputting the other part of the DFB fiber laser (40) to the outside, wherein the optical fiber forming the optical feedback path (50) is longer than a length provided by relaxed oscillation noise having -110dB/Hz in an output to the outside.
